Nearly 700,000 LGBTQ Americans between 18 and 59 years old have undergone conversion therapy, the controversial practice of trying to change an individual’s sexual orientation, at some point in their lives, according to a report by the Williams Institute at the University of California, Los Angeles.

Garrard Conley was one of them, an ordeal he wrote about in “Boy Erased,” a memoir that has now been adapted into a feature film. Conley joined NBC OUT, NBC News and NBC News THINK to talk about his experience.

Danica Roem Is Much More Than A Transgender Politician

In 2017, Democrat Danica Roem made history when she became the first openly transgender person to be elected to Virginia’s state legislature. But she’s more than just her gender identity. She’s a former newspaper reporter and editor, and she’s had a busy first year in Virginia’s statehouse. Roem spoke to NBC News, NBC News THINK and NBC OUT at the Victory Institute’s 2018 International LGBTQ Leaders Summit in Washington DC.

Lupe Valdez, Democratic Gubernatorial Candidate in Texas

It’s an uphill battle for Lupe Valdez, the Democratic gubernatorial candidate in Texas, a state that hasn’t elected a Democrat to statewide office in nearly half a century. But Valdez is used to uphill battles – she’s the state’s first openly gay and first Latina sheriff. Valdez joined NBC News THINK, NBC OUT and NBC LATINO to talk about her campaign.
